feat(claude): add model alias mapping and improve key normalization
- Introduced model alias mapping for Claude configurations, enabling upstream and client-facing model name associations. - Added `computeClaudeModelsHash` to generate a consistent hash for model aliases. - Implemented `normalizeClaudeKey` function to standardize input API key configuration, including models. - Enhanced executor to resolve model aliases to upstream names dynamically. - Updated documentation and configuration examples to reflect new model alias support.
